Descrizione:
Poli(I:C), o acido poliinosinico-policitidico, è una molecola di RNA a doppia catena sintetica che funge da potente immunostimolante. È principalmente riconosciuto per il suo ruolo nel mimare le infezioni virali, attivando così la risposta immunitaria, in particolare attraverso la stimolazione dei recettori tipo Toll (TLRs), specificamente TLR3. Questa attivazione porta alla produzione di varie citochine e interferoni, migliorando le difese antivirali del corpo. Poli(I:C) è spesso utilizzato nella ricerca e nelle applicazioni terapeutiche, incluso lo sviluppo di vaccini e l'immunoterapia contro il cancro, grazie alla sua capacità di indurre una risposta immunitaria robusta. La sostanza è tipicamente caratterizzata dal suo alto peso molecolare ed è solubile in acqua, rendendola adatta per vari saggi biologici. Inoltre, Poli(I:C) può essere modificato per migliorare la sua stabilità e efficacia, ad esempio attraverso l'incorporazione di modifiche chimiche che aumentano la sua resistenza alla degradazione da parte delle nucleasi. In generale, Poli(I:C) è uno strumento prezioso in immunologia e ricerca terapeutica, contribuendo alla nostra comprensione dei meccanismi immunitari e delle potenziali strategie di trattamento.

CAS:<p>Polyinosinic acid-polycytidylic acid (Poly I:C), an agonist of TLR3 toll-like receptors, is a synthetic double-stranded RNA analog, consisting of polyinosinic acid (poly I) paired with polycytidylic acid (poly C), forming a stable duplex structure.PolyI:C stimulates the secretion of pro-inflammatory cytokines and type I interferon through its interaction with endosomal Toll-like receptor 3 (TLR-3) and the cytoplasmic receptors melanoma differentiation-associated gene 5 (MDA-5) and retinoic acid-inducible gene I (RIG-I). This immunostimulant activity makes Poly I:C a useful vaccine adjuvant and is used in vaccine formulations. Poly I:C and its stabilized analogs (e.g., poly-ICLC) are also being actively researched for their dual role in oncology: directly targeting tumors and acting as immune potentiators.
